LONDRES (AP) — Llegó la hora. El duelo más esperado de los Juegos Olímpicos subirá el domingo al escenario estelar del atletismo: Usain Bolt vs. Yohan Blake.

Los bólidos jamaicanos tendrán que sortear primero las semifinales de los 100 metros, pero a menos que ocurra alguna sorpresa, deben verse las caras por la noche en el Estadio Olímpico de Londres para decidir quién es el hombre más rápido del planeta.

Ambos superaron el sábado sin dificultades el trámite de las preliminares. Blake lo consiguió con el tercer mejor tiempo de todas las series (10.00) y Bolt con un 10.09, aunque quedó claro que corrieron a media máquina. Los estadounidenses Ryan Bailey (9.88) y Justin Gatlin (9.97) fueron los más veloces.

De todas formas, la atención estará posada sobre los portentos caribeños.

Bolt fue el rey absoluto de la pista hace cuatro años en Beijing, donde ganó con récords mundiales los 100, 200 y 4x100, mientras que Blake ha surgido como su némesis desde que conquistó el Mundial del año pasado y lo venció hace poco en el preolímpico de Jamaica.

"Estoy ansioso por correr las semifinales mañana", comentó Bolt, quien asegura haber dejado atrás las molestias físicas que lo aquejaron en meses recientes. "Las piernas están bien, mi entrenamiento ha sido fabuloso".

Este no será el único duelo de lujo el domingo, cuando comienza la segunda mitad de los Juegos. La atención también se posará sobre el césped de Wimbledon, donde el suizo Roger Federer y el británico Andy Murray disputarán la final del tenis de hombres.

Federer venció a Murray hace un mes en la final de Wimbledon, por lo que el público británico palpita una revancha en la que salga airoso su consentido. Pase lo que pase, Federer ya aseguró su primera medalla olímpica en singles.

"Espero que sea un gran partido", comentó Murray. "Creo que el torneo se merece una gran final. Espero que podamos dársela".

La jornada que pone en marcha la segunda mitad de los Juegos reparte 23 medallas de oro, incluyendo el maratón de mujeres y las dos primeras en la lucha grecorromana,

La colombiana Caterine Ibargüen, medallista de bronce en el pasado mundial, competirá en la final del salto triple, mientras que el dominicano Luguelín Santos correrá en las semifinales de los 400 metros, en las que también estará el sudafricano Oscar Pistorius, el primer atleta con las piernas amputadas que compite en unos Juegos Olímpicos.

El boxeo de mujeres debutará en las olimpiadas, mientras que la rama masculina tendrá sus primeros medallistas cuando se disputen los cuartos de final de las divisiones gallo y completo, en las que hay dos cubanos, un mexicano, un argentino y un brasileño. Los cuatro semifinalistas en el boxeo aseguran al menos un bronce.
